This Sensor Is a Recreation Changer



As the best athletes on the earth as soon as once more assemble for the Olympic video games, we’re reminded simply how intensely aggressive skilled sports activities will be. Gaining even a small edge over one other competitor could make the distinction between standing tall on the world stage and being despatched again dwelling for an additional 4 years. So to maintain their expertise sharp, skilled athletes spend a variety of time training their craft to enhance their expertise. However when one achieves a really excessive degree of efficiency, it may be tough to even discover the small, incremental enhancements which are achieved by follow. So many athletes and trainers are more and more turning to know-how to observe and excellent all kinds of expertise.

Wearable sensors have confirmed to be very priceless for functions akin to this. They will exactly measure actions of the physique in real-time, offering on the spot suggestions to the athlete. Even issues that could be too small or too quick to be seen by a human coach will be detected by these units, enabling a a lot finer degree of ability tuning than would in any other case be attainable.

Nevertheless, if they aren’t rigorously designed, the wearable sensors themselves can get in the best way and intervene with coaching and efficiency enchancment. Which may be much less of a priority sooner or later, nevertheless, because of the work of researchers at Lyuliang College. They’ve developed a cushty sensing system for athletes that may bend and twist with out limiting joint motion. The sensors are additionally self-powered and have been proven to be fairly correct.

Badminton will not be the most well-liked sport, however it is named a recreation that requires a substantial amount of pace and precision to excel at. The entire physique is concerned in badminton, from exact footwork to exacting arm swings. It is because of this that the researchers constructed their sensing system, initially a minimum of, to observe badminton gamers.

A key element of the strategy includes using triboelectric sensors. These sensors make use of disparate supplies that switch an electrical cost from one to the opposite once they come into contact. The quantity of cost that’s produced can be utilized for sensing motion of the physique half that they’re hooked up to. The supplies themselves generate this cost as they slide previous each other, so no batteries or exterior sources of energy are wanted, which makes the triboelectric sensors small, versatile, and comfy to put on.

The primary sensor of this sort designed by the crew was a 3D-printed versatile arch that may be worn within the shoe. It was encased in a thermoplastic elastomer to attenuate sources of interference and improve its sensing accuracy. Whereas not but confirmed, it’s believed that the identical strategies also needs to work for measuring actions on the wrists, elbows, shoulders, fingers, knee joints, and different areas of the physique.

To make sense of the info captured from the sensor, the researchers developed a neural community classifier. It was educated to acknowledge numerous badminton strikes, such because the forehand serve, backhand serve, forehand hook, and backhand hook. Experiments revealed that this method accurately categorised the strikes in 97.2 % of circumstances.

This work proves that on-body sensing options will be unobtrusive and but present correct outcomes. With some refinement, this know-how could possibly be tailored to work for different sports activities, and even for a wide range of well being monitoring functions.
